262.14k tokensFrequently Asked Questions about Gemini 3.1 Flash-Lite vs Mistral Medium 3.5
Gemini 3.1 Flash-Lite is cheaper than Mistral Medium 3.5. Gemini 3.1 Flash-Lite has a blended cost of $0.56/1M tokens, which is about 5.3x cheaper than Mistral Medium 3.5 at $3.00/1M tokens.
